# Sweepline — data-retention sweeper (team Nocturne)
# New folks: this env file drives the nightly purge of expired records.
# SWEEP_WINDOW controls the cutoff in days; never set below 30.
# SWEEP_DRY_RUN=1 is the default in staging — leave it.
# The sweeper authenticates to the audit ledger with a token.
# Set it on the next line:

env line for fafof-fahag: LEDGER_TOKEN5=f8790

**Action Item 7:** Document the resolver batching pattern introduced after the Pellwick outage. The N+1 fix in the Orchardline GraphQL gateway relies on request-scoped loaders, and new resolvers must use them — a single unbatched resolver reintroduced the problem twice last quarter. New team members should review the loader lifecycle and the caching caveats before writing resolvers. The write-up, with annotated examples, is on the internal page below.

operations page: https://jenkins.zemvarcloud.local/job/merge_requests/repo/build/73930b4b30f0a8ed

Subject: Support Outsourcing — Branch Update

Team,

Tier 1 support for the Lanroth platform moves to Corvale Assist next month. Branch managers will retain local escalation ownership; handoff procedures go out Thursday. Headcount at branches is unaffected this quarter. Questions go through your regional lead. The reasoning behind the timing is in the note below.

board note of kageg-bahof: The renewal with Holwynax Holdings closes at $2 million a year, 5 percent below the last contract. Project Ulaath slips by two quarters because of the supplier delay.

FAQ — Bucketeer assignment service

Q: Why does the reviewer sandbox reject assignment calls?
A: The sandbox vault seals after 24h idle. Assignments are deterministic per unit ID, so resealing never changes buckets. Reviewers should not approve changes to the hashing salt. To unseal the sandbox vault and resume testing, enter the recovery passphrase:

unlock words, hahip-baduf: holwyn-istath-julvan